Lines Matching defs:first
537 bind(BindableIterator first, BindableIterator last)
539 return bind(first, last, this->begin());
544 bind(BindableIterator first, BindableIterator last, iterator from)
546 if (!size() || from == end() || first == last)
549 while (from != end() && first != last)
550 (*from++).bind(*first++);
570 operator () (ArgumentIterator first, ArgumentIterator last)
572 return (*this)(first, last, this->begin());
577 operator () (ArgumentIterator first, ArgumentIterator last, iterator from)
579 if (!size() || from == end() || first == last)
582 while (from != end() && first != last)
583 (*from++)(*first++);
704 bind(BindableIterator first, BindableIterator last)
706 return bind(first, last, this->begin());
711 bind(BindableIterator first, BindableIterator last, iterator from)
713 if (!size() || from == end() || first == last)
716 while (from != end() && first != last)
717 (*from++).bind(*first++);
723 bind(BindableIterator first, BindableIterator last,
726 return bind(first, last, iterator(from.it_, ptr_));
745 operator () (ArgumentIterator first, ArgumentIterator last)
747 return (*this)(first, last, this->begin());
752 operator () (ArgumentIterator first, ArgumentIterator last, iterator from)
754 if (!size() || from == end() || first == last)
757 while (from != end() && first != last)
758 (*from++)(*first++);
764 operator () (ArgumentIterator first, ArgumentIterator last,
767 return (*this)(first, last, iterator(from.it_, ptr_));